What they do

A Cook prepares food in a restaurant or institutional kitchen. May be responsible for a specific station or type of food preparation in a larger kitchen, or specialize as a short-order or fast-food cook. May prepare meals in private homes, or cater parties.

$31,126 / year median in Georgia

+1% projected growth
